Output e373d3b6cebbdfa05ab6f1422d141cccf4cab89c0a053cd5bd228cb796ded00a:0

value
5981438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80018c97198b3e655cf9877fff46aec0f5e984ef OP_EQUAL
address
3DMrGjhXiNLX2BM2YbZyu9oKs8WjBPua53
transaction
e373d3b6cebbdfa05ab6f1422d141cccf4cab89c0a053cd5bd228cb796ded00a
confirmations
321870
spent
true